jQuery获取class items
在现代的网页开发中,jQuery已经成为了一种广泛使用的JavaScript库,它为开发者提供了强大的DOM操作和简化的事件处理能力。本文将介绍如何利用jQuery获取具有特定类名的DOM元素,并通过示例展示如何使用这些元素进行进一步的操作。
什么是jQuery?
jQuery是一个快速、简洁的JavaScript库,旨在简化HTML文档的遍历和操作、事件处理、动画以及Ajax交互。由于其兼容性和易用性,jQuery在网页开发中得到了广泛的应用。
获取class items的基本语法
使用jQuery获取具有特定类名的元素非常简单。基本语法如下:
$('.class_name')
这里的.class_name
是我们要获取的类名,可以替换成任何有效的类名。
示例 1:获取并打印class items
下面是一个简单的例子,展示如何获取并打印具有特定类名的元素。
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>获取class items示例</title>
<script src="
<script>
$(document).ready(function() {
var items = $('.item');
items.each(function(index, element) {
console.log($(element).text());
});
});
</script>
</head>
<body>
<div class="item">项目1</div>
<div class="item">项目2</div>
<div class="item">项目3</div>
</body>
</html>
在这个示例中,我们首先引入了jQuery库,然后在文档加载完成后,通过$('.item')
获取所有具有类名item
的元素,并将其文本打印到控制台。
链式调用
jQuery的一大特点是支持链式调用。你可以在获取元素后立即对其进行其他操作。例如,我们可以同时更改每个具有特定类名的元素的样式和文本:
$('.item').css('color', 'red').text('更新后的项目');
获取多个class items
有时,我们需要获取多个类名的元素。在这种情况下,我们可以使用逗号分隔的类名,如下所示:
$('.item1, .item2')
示例 2:获取多个class items
下面的例子展示了如何获取多个类名的元素,并更改它们的样式。
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>获取多个class items示例</title>
<script src="
<script>
$(document).ready(function() {
$('.item1, .item2').css('color', 'blue');
});
</script>
</head>
<body>
<div class="item1">项目1</div>
<div class="item2">项目2</div>
</body>
</html>
在这个示例中,我们获取了类名为item1
和item2
的元素,并将它们的文本颜色更改为蓝色。
动态添加class items
在有些情况下,我们可能需要动态添加具有特定类名的元素。这也是jQuery非常擅长的任务。使用append()
或prepend()
方法可以轻松地向列表或容器中添加新元素。
示例 3:动态添加class items
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>动态添加class items示例</title>
<script src="
<script>
$(document).ready(function() {
$('#addItemButton').on('click', function() {
$('#itemList').append('<div class="item">新项目</div>');
});
});
</script>
</head>
<body>
<button id="addItemButton">添加项目</button>
<div id="itemList"></div>
</body>
</html>
在此示例中,用户可以点击“添加项目”按钮,触发添加具有类名item
的新元素的操作。
使用饼状图展示数据
为了更好地展示从DOM元素中获取的数据,我们可以使用图表工具。下面是一个使用Mermaid语法绘制饼状图的示例。
pie
title 项目分布
"项目1": 30
"项目2": 50
"项目3": 20
结论
本文介绍了如何使用jQuery获取具有特定类名的元素,并通过多种示例展示了这一功能的强大和灵活性。无论是在静态页面还是动态内容生成中,jQuery都可以显著提高开发效率。希望本文能帮助你更好地理解和应用jQuery获取class items的相关知识,提升你的网页开发能力。通过实践这些技巧,你将能更灵活地操作DOM,创建更具吸引力和互动性的网页。